Soldier Given LSD in ’58 Settles Suit for $400,000

A former soldier given LSD nearly 40 years ago in experiments by the Army and the CIA won more than $400,000 from arbitrators to settle his lawsuit against the government.

The three-member panel ruled in a split decision Monday that the government owed James Stanley, 62, of nearby Palm Springs $400,577 for secretly giving him LSD in 1958. He was then a young soldier who thought he was participating in a test of equipment and clothing.
